Abstract

The present invention relates to a lighting device with an electrified track and with high-efficiency lighting elements, comprising a profiled body (1) which defines means for releasable engagement with a contact element (4) supporting at least one light source. The distinguishing feature of the invention is that the light source is a LED- type lighting element (10) and the contact element (4) comprises a plate (4a) which supports the LED-type lighting element (10) and defines electrically- conductive portions (7) which can be arranged in contact with the electrical conductors (8) provided in the profiled body (1 ).

Description

A lighting device with an electrified track and with high-efficiency lighting elements
Technical field
The present invention relates to a lighting device with an electrified track and with high-efficiency lighting elements. Technological background
As is known, electrified bars are already used in the lighting field and are constituted in general by profiled sections, inside which seats are defined for housing electrical conductors, and which have further seats for the mechanical engagement of a lighting body which can be positioned freely at any point on the track.
In the solutions of the prior art which have electrified tracks or bars, it is possible at the moment to use only incandescent lamps or halogen lamps and, because of the types of lamps which necessarily have to be used, they do not fully solve the various lighting problems. Lighting elements of the LED type, which are used, for example, for lighting in furniture and kitchens and which have a particularly good type of light, as well as "sport ring" LEDs, which have a plurality of lighting elements distributed on a single plate in a manner such as to have a characteristic illumination which is
, optimal in many situations, are also known commercially. However, lamps of this type have the disadvantage of having particularly rigid and restrictive elements for connection to the supports so that their installation becomes problematical in many situations and, moreover, is not such as to allow free positioning of the light sources. Description of the invention The aim of the invention is precisely to eliminate the disadvantages discussed above, providing a lighting device with an electrified track and with high-efficiency lighting elements which enables the types of lamps usable with the tracks to be extended considerably, thus achieving a considerable improvement in lighting quality. Another object of the present invention is to provide a track lighting device in which the configuration and aesthetic type of the lamp can be changed, without the need to change the technical connection characteristics. Yet another object of the present invention is to provide a lighting device which, owing to its particular constructional features, can provide very extensive guarantees of reliability and safety in use.
A principal object of the present invention is to provide an electrified track with high-efficiency lighting elements which can easily be produced from conventional commercially-available materials and which is also competitive from a purely economic point of view.
The aim set forth above, as well as the objects mentioned and others which will become clearer from the following, are achieved by a lighting device with an electrified track and with high-efficiency lighting elements according to the invention, comprising a profiled body defining means for releasable engagement with a contact element supporting at least one light source, characterized in that the at least one light source is a LED-type lighting element and in that the contact element comprises a plate supporting the LED-type lighting element and defining electrically-conductive portions which can be arranged in contact with electrical conductors provided in the profiled body. A lighting device with an electrified track and with high-efficiency lighting elements according to the invention, is described with reference to the drawings mentioned and, in particular to Figures 1 and 2; the lighting device comprises a profiled body, generally indicated 1 , which is advantageously substantially C- shaped in cross-section with an open portion partially closed by lips 2 which are resiliently yielding since they are made of elastomeric material, such as synthetic mouldings. Defined inside the profiled body 1 are means for releasable engagement with a contact element, generally indicated 4, which supports a light source.
The engagement means are preferably formed by an engagement seat 5. A first important feature of the invention is that the light source is constituted by a LED-type lighting element, indicated 10, which projects from the resilient lips 2, thus enabling access to the interior of the profiled body which constitutes the track to be closed against dust and dirt whilst permitting easy movement of the assembly.
The contact 4 is preferably formed by a plate 4a which has on its surface, a printed circuit defining electrically-conductive portions, the conductive surfaces 7 of which can be positioned in the region of electrical conductors 8 which are provided inside the profiled body 1 in order to perform the electrical connection of the lighting element 10. The conductive surfaces 7 form "flash"-type contacts and are gold-plated to a thickness of 35 //m.
A high-dissipation material known by the trade name THERMACLED, covered by a ceramic insulator processed under vacuum, is used, for example, to form the plate 4a, permitting good electrical insulation between the contacts 7 and rapid heat dissipation. Moreover, a layer of silk-screen printing ink is interposed between the two contacts 7, covering the ceramic insulation, to insulate the two contacts 7 from one another, thus achieving a degree of insulation of 6000 V. The LED 10 is fixed to the plate 4a by means of a two-part, thermally- conductive glue and is soldered by means of a tin-lead alloy. The LED 10 is supplied with energy with the interposition of an electrical resistance (not shown) to limit the current supplied to the LED 10 and thus to enable several LEDs 10, mounted on different plates 4a, to be mounted in parallel. To keep the conductive surfaces 7 correctly in contact with the conductor
8, a resilient projection 15 is provided inside the profiled body and, in practice, is formed by a bridge which joins the opposed inside edges of the profiled body 1 and engages a central portion of the plate 4a, which is thus kept pressed against the conductors 8, forming a firm contact therewith. The plate 4a which supports the LED can be positioned inside the profiled body simply by sliding, since it is fitted in from the exterior and is brought to the desired position simply by sliding.
The arched bridge in practice forms a spring which maintains the electrical contact for the LED.
With reference to Figures 3 to 6, a lighting element, again formed by a LED 10 supported by the plate 4a, is provided and is housed inside a casing, indicated 20 and constituted by a base 21 connected to which is a cover 22 which defines the opening 23, through which the LED projects.
The casing also has a foot 30 which permits connection to a general track, indicated 31 , which is electrified. The foot 30 is constituted by an oblong body 33 which has one dimension such that it can be inserted between arms 32 of the track 31 , and a larger, transverse dimension so that it can be locked beneath the arms 32 by rotation through 90°.
The casing 20 has the characteristic that it defines, in its interior, connection contacts, indicated 40, which engage the conductive surfaces 7 of the plate 4a and project to the exterior, defining arc-like contact elements 41 which extend in the region of the foot 30 and can be arranged in electrical contact with the conductors that are provided on the track 33, as shown in Figure 3.
Resilient plates 35 are also provided inside the casing and have the function of maintaining the correct position of the element for contact with the lighting element inside the casing.
It is pointed out that the casing can act as a decorative element which may adopt any desired shape, for example, a stylized flower corolla. It is clear from the foregoing description that the invention achieves the objects proposed and, in particular, it is stressed that the invention provides a lighting device with an electrified track which makes it possible to use LED-type lighting elements particularly advantageously.

Claims

Claims
1. A lighting device with an electrified track and with high-efficiency lighting elements, comprising a profiled body (1 ) defining means for releasable engagement with a contact element (4) supporting at least one light source, characterized in that the at least one light source is a LED-type lighting element (10) and in that the contact element (4) comprises a plate (4a) supporting the LED-type lighting element (10) and defining electrically-conductive portions (7) which can be arranged in contact with electrical conductors (8, 40) provided in the profiled body (1 ).
2. A lighting device according to the preceding claim, characterized in that the profiled body (1 ) is substantially C-shaped and defines an opening delimited by a pair of opposed, resiliently deformable lips (2).
3. A lighting device according to the preceding claims, characterized in that it comprises, on the plate (4a), a printed circuit defining the electrically-conductive portions (7).
4. A lighting device according to one or more of the preceding claims, characterized in that the profiled body (1) has, in its interior, a bridge element (15) suitable for acting as a spring in order to exert a resilient pressure on the plate (4a) in order to keep the electrically-conductive portions (7) in contact with the electrical conductors (8, 40).
5. A lighting device according to one or more of the preceding claims, characterized in that the plate (4a) with the LED-type lighting element (10) can be housed in a casing (20) which can be connected releasably to an electrified track (31 ).
6. A lighting device according to one or more of the preceding claims, characterized in that the casing (20) defines an engagement foot (30) with an oblong body (33) having one dimension which is suitable for permitting its insertion in an opening of the electrified track (31 ), the other dimension being larger to allow the foot (30) to be locked in the electrified track (31 ) by their relative rotation.
7. A lighting device according to one or more of the preceding claims, characterized in that it comprises, inside the casing (20), auxiliary contacts (40) which can be arranged in contact with the electrically-conductive portions (7) and which have respective arc-like contact portions (41) that are accessible from the exterior in order to be put in contact with the conductors of the electrified track (31 ).
8. A lighting device according to one or more of the preceding claims, characterized in that it comprises, inside the casing (20), resilient plates (35) for keeping the plate (4a) pressed resiliently against the auxiliary contacts (40).
9. A lighting device according to one or more of the preceding claims, characterized in that the casing (20) is shaped as a decorative element.
10. A device according to Claim 9 in which the casing (20) is associated with the foot (30) interchangeably.
